    Gelcomm is a creative agency specializing in consumer-first branding. For over 20 years, they have developed forward-thinking design and comprehensive communications strategy for partners big and small—from Fortune 100 companies looking to extend their legacy to start-ups in need of an experienced branding partner. Whether they are delivering solutions for consumer package goods, entertainment branding, licensing, or consumer research, every detail of all the process is honed by tireless market awareness and thoughtful human insight.

    Intermark Group is the largest psychology-driven marketing agency in the country. Intermark Group shapes success by applying persuasive psychology to group imagination and data liberation. It's a potent branding cocktail. They have a unique viewpoint on brand building. The world is always changing. That's life. Brands change too. They evolve to meet new channels, audiences and offerings. But brands can't change themselves. Change is a group thing, certainly an Intermark Group thing. They unite advertising, media planning and buying, public relations, social media, interactive, strategic services, analytics and production to shape remarkable success stories for a variety of regional and national clients.
